    Q3. What is the best season for rafting in Nepal?

    • Spring (March–May) – warm weather, great water levels.
    • Autumn (September–November) – stable climate, clear skies, perfect for long expeditions.
    • Monsoon (June–August) – high water, only for experienced rafters.
    • Winter (December–February) – shorter trips possible, but colder.

    Q4. What class of rapids will I face?

    • Karnali River – Class III–V (challenging, big waves, technical rapids).
    • Bheri River – Class II–III (moderate, good for families and beginners).
    • Seti Karnali – Class III–IV (fun and adventurous, great for wilderness lovers).

Q1. What fish species can I catch in Karnali and Bheri rivers?
Our fishing expeditions target Golden Mahseer, Snow Trout, and Goonch Catfish, some of the most legendary freshwater species in South Asia.

Q1. What wildlife can I see on a jungle safari?
In Bardia & Chitwan National Parks, you can see:

  • Royal Bengal Tiger

  • One-horned Rhinoceros

  • Asian Elephants

  • Crocodiles, deer, and over 500 bird species
